Self-defense classes offered at Louisville Fire Station

Posted

LOUISVILLE — The Louisville Neighborhood Watch committee is working with Massena Zen-Do Kai Karate instructors to host an adult self-defense class at the Louisville Fire Station, State Route 37, on Tuesday, Nov. 29, and Thursday, Dec. 1, from 6-8 p.m.

Anyone over the age of 18 is welcome.

The class is limited to 30 participants.

Wear comfortable clothing.

There will be personal contact, but participants will not be injured in any way.

Instructors will cover the six most common attacks.

Call ahead to get registered for the class, as it is first-come-first-served for a spot in the class.
